on-

Signification (English)

  1. (morpheme) un-, in- (expresses negation)
  2. (morpheme) bad, grave, horrifying

Étymologie (English)

In summary

From Middle Dutch on-, from Old Dutch un-, from Proto-West Germanic *un-, from Proto-Germanic *un-, from Proto-Indo-European *n̥-.
